Goal: Replace 1C with a flexible open-source ERP. Basic trading logic is needed + integration with Ukrainian services + the ability to connect our AI agent.Mandatory functionality Basic ERP logic Counterparties, invoices, incoming/outgoing waybills, inventory accounting. Sales, orders, pricing. Integration with Nova Poshta Two-way exchange: creation of EN, printing waybill, delivery statuses. Cost calculation. Integration with marketplaces (two-way) Prom.ua – products, orders, stock. Rozetka – the same. Epicentr – the same (if there is an API – use it, if not – through a universal connector). Synchronization of nomenclature from an external database Products and prices are automatically pulled from another database (for example, via REST API or SQL connection). Periodic synchronization is needed. Integration with our AI agent Via REST API Odoo. The agent will be able to read/write data (for example, generate product descriptions, forecast stock, process orders). Localization for Ukraine Chart of accounts, tax invoices, PRRO (Checkbox), reporting.
I'm looking for a attentive and systematic assistant to manage the client database of a small coffee business. I need help organizing a simple and clear client accounting system. At the initial stage, this could be a well-set-up Google Sheet, Notion, or an inexpensive CRM. I will consider your suggestions for the most convenient and budget-friendly solution. What needs to be considered for each client: name and contact details; source of inquiry, such as advertising, Instagram, recommendation; date of first contact; what the client purchased; which types and flavor profiles of coffee they liked; method of coffee preparation; history and approximate frequency of orders; date of next contact; comments and important details of correspondence. I'm primarily looking for a reasonable and economical solution for a small business, so expensive and complex CRMs are not being considered at this stage. At the first stage, the main focus is on systematizing information and reminders. Later, we can discuss the independent sending of agreed messages to clients.
